In February 2008, Karen Armstrong was awarded the TED Prize, and, in accepting it, made a wish that a community of thinkers and spiritual leaders would come together to create a Charter for Compassion. In November 2009, the Charter was unveiled. In her new book, Twelve Steps to a Compassionate Life, Karen suggests actions that one might take to increase the compassion in one’s daily life. At CharterForCompassion.org, Karen and her collaborators have created a free reading group guide to facilitate group creation and further discussion.
